Bart Gadau was a 2012 Libertarian candidate who sought election to the U.S. House to represent the 8th Congressional District of Indiana.

Gadau lost to Republican incumbent Larry Bucshon on November 6, 2012.[1]

Gadau ran in the 2012 election for the U.S. House to represent Indiana's 8th District. Gadau ran as a Libertarian candidate and was defeated by incumbent Larry Bucshon (R) in the general election.[2] The general election took place on November 6, 2012.

U.S. House, Indiana District 8 General Election, 2012
Party Candidate Vote % Votes
     Democratic Dave Crooks 43.1% 122,325
     Republican Green check mark transparent.pngLarry Bucshon Incumbent 53.4% 151,533
     Libertarian Bart Gadau 3.6% 10,134
Total Votes 283,992
Source: Indiana Secretary of State "House of Representatives Election Results"
